Light Weight Concrete
BDR LiteCrete
BDR LiteCrete is a next-generation lightweight concrete developed by introducing controlled foam into the concrete matrix. The foam is generated separately using a synthetic-based air-entraining agent and a foam generator.
The entrained air creates uniformly distributed micro-bubbles within the concrete, significantly reducing its density and overall dead weight when compared to conventional concrete, while maintaining adequate strength for non-structural applications.
Applications
- Lightweight topping over roof slabs
- Thermal insulation layer on rooftops
- Sound insulation layer over intermediate slabs
- Filling of sunken slabs in toilets after pipeline installation
- Screed concrete layer over raceways in commercial buildings
- Filling of trenches in roadways
- Filling of cable trenches that may require future access for repairs

Technical Properties
- Minimum Density: ~ 1000 kg/m³ (approx.)
- Cement Type: Compatible with any cement combination
- Aggregate Size: No coarse aggregates used
- Workability: Collapse (self-leveling nature)
- Strength Class: 2–5 MPa at 28 days
Special Instructions
- Use low pumping pressures to prevent loss of entrained air
- Not recommended for wearing or traffic-bearing surfaces
- Concrete must be placed within the stipulated design time
